Pomelos are also highly nutritious and are a good food source for dieters. This is because 150 grams of pomelo, which is equal to approximately 1/4 cup, contains 60 calories. Additionally, pomelos do not contain any cholesterol, fat, or sodium. Pomelo is an excellent source of vitamin C and also rich in sugar, vitamin A, B 1 , B 2 and B 12 .
